A square tile of white recycled plastic, its surface scattered with small bright flecks of red, blue, green and yellow.

Marble plastic is a sheet good made from 100 percent recycled plastic from a diverse range of byproduct materials including electronics, tv screens, bread tags, refrigerator liners, and more. The sheets are handcrafted into durable, high-quality surfaces.
